Meaning of roding |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B1

Definitions

  1. The mating display of the male woodcock, consisting of a patrolling flight around its territory.
    countable, uncountable
  2. A river in Essex and Greater London, England, which flows into Barking Creek before it reaches the Thames near Barking.
  3. A small boat's anchor line.
    countable

Examples

“Three boats found their rodings fouled by these reckless mid-sea hunters, and were towed half a mile ere their horses shook the line free.”
